diff --git a/.htaccess b/.htaccess new file mode 100644 index 0000000..729648d --- /dev/null +++ b/.htaccess @@ -0,0 +1,23 @@ +RewriteEngine On +RewriteCond %{HTTP:X-Forwarded-Proto} !https +RewriteRule (.*) https://%{HTTP_HOST}%{REQUEST_URI} [R=301,L] + + +Deny from all + + +Deny from all + + +Options +FollowSymLinks +RewriteEngine on +RewriteCond %{HTTP_HOST} ^https://blogbaster.xyz/ +RewriteCond %{THE_REQUEST} ^[A-Z]{3,9}\ /index\.php\ HTTP/ +RewriteRule ^index\.html$ https://blogbaster.xyz/ [R=301,L] +RewriteRule ^index.html$ / [QSA,R] +RewriteCond %{REQUEST_FILENAME} !-f +RewriteCond %{REQUEST_FILENAME} !-d +RewriteCond %{REQUEST_FILENAME}.html -f +RewriteRule ^.*$ $0.php [L,QSA] +RewriteCond %{THE_REQUEST} ([^\s]*)\.html(\?[^\s]*)? +RewriteRule (.*) %1 [R=301,L] diff --git a/public/htaccess b/public/htaccess new file mode 100644 index 0000000..729648d --- /dev/null +++ b/public/htaccess @@ -0,0 +1,23 @@ +RewriteEngine On +RewriteCond %{HTTP:X-Forwarded-Proto} !https +RewriteRule (.*) https://%{HTTP_HOST}%{REQUEST_URI} [R=301,L] + + +Deny from all + + +Deny from all + + +Options +FollowSymLinks +RewriteEngine on +RewriteCond %{HTTP_HOST} ^https://blogbaster.xyz/ +RewriteCond %{THE_REQUEST} ^[A-Z]{3,9}\ /index\.php\ HTTP/ +RewriteRule ^index\.html$ https://blogbaster.xyz/ [R=301,L] +RewriteRule ^index.html$ / [QSA,R] +RewriteCond %{REQUEST_FILENAME} !-f +RewriteCond %{REQUEST_FILENAME} !-d +RewriteCond %{REQUEST_FILENAME}.html -f +RewriteRule ^.*$ $0.php [L,QSA] +RewriteCond %{THE_REQUEST} ([^\s]*)\.html(\?[^\s]*)? +RewriteRule (.*) %1 [R=301,L]